Hispanic poverty in Redding, California compared

How does Redding, California compare to other California and National averages?

  • Redding, California

    16%

  • California

    14.4% (-10% lower than Redding, California)

  • National average

    16.6% (4% higher than Redding, California)

Historical Timeline

16% Poverty Rate for Hispanics in Redding, California historical data

  • 2011 - 19.2%

    The 2011 19.2% is the baseline measurement.

  • 2012 - 13.8%

    The 2012 decrease to 13.8% from 2011 represents a -5.4% decrease YoY.

  • 2013 - 16.3%

    The 2013 increase to 16.3% from 2012 represents a 2.5% increase YoY.

  • 2014 - 16.8%

    The 2014 increase to 16.8% from 2013 represents a 0.5% increase YoY.

  • 2015 - 41.3%

    The 2015 increase to 41.3% from 2014 represents a 24.5% increase YoY.

  • 2016 - 26.5%

    The 2016 decrease to 26.5% from 2015 represents a -14.8% decrease YoY.

  • 2017 - 28.4%

    The 2017 increase to 28.4% from 2016 represents a 1.9% increase YoY.

  • 2018 - 23.6%

    The 2018 decrease to 23.6% from 2017 represents a -4.8% decrease YoY.

  • 2019 - 20.2%

    The 2019 decrease to 20.2% from 2018 represents a -3.4% decrease YoY.

  • 2021 - 15.9%

    The 2021 decrease to 15.9% from 2019 represents a -4.3% decrease YoY.

  • 2022 - 18%

    The 2022 increase to 18% from 2021 represents a 2.1% increase YoY.

  • 2023 - 16%

    The 2023 decrease to 16% from 2022 represents a -2.0% decrease YoY.
